Linux didn't just eat 10% of Windows market share, AI bots are inflating the numbers

www.windowslatest.com/2026/08/03/linux-didnt-just-eat-10-of-windows-market-share-ai-bots-are-inflating-the-numbers/
Windows LatestLinux didn't just eat 10% of Windows market share, AI bots are inflating the numbersNo, Linux desktop market share has not crossed 10% in North America, and Windows is not suddenly losing millions of users. 2026 is not the year of Linux, for those who care. If anything, it’s the year the internet died, because the entire spike appears to be driven by AI bots. Almost every month, we […]
